... Nice shot Pat, they all look the same to me? The hummers at my place are mostly greenish gray? They'd be Anna's. I see them around here almost all the time. The females are grayish with green backs. When I originally posted this one I didn't pay much attention to it when I was processing it except to determine that it was an immature female. So I called it a female Anna's. Later I happened to be purging a bunch of pics from my "Sent" file and I took a second look at her and realized she'd a sort of tannish rusty color - not gray. Don't know how I missed that the first time. -- Paddy's Pig ------------ To reply its bell not bull |
